Weeping Willow Tea Room
Open
128 W Central St
Bethalto, IL 62010
Weeping Willow Tea Room in Bethalto, Illinois, offers a delightful dining experience focused on lunch and dessert, emphasizing gathering in a warm, welcoming atmosphere. The establishment operates on a first-come, first-served basis, encouraging guests to arrive early to secure seating, especially during peak hours.
With limited capacity for larger parties, the tea room promotes an intimate setting where guests can enjoy a diverse menu while being mindful of their dining experience. Their commitment to exceptional service is reflected in their open invitation for patrons to savor every moment spent at their establishment.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.